      It's estimated that during the Christmas period three animals are abandoned every hour, resulting in many animal rescue centres seeing a huge influx of people looking to rehome dogs this time of year. So who better to see first hand the incredible work done up and down the country by rescue centres than the newest member of our This Morning family - former Crufts commentator and Blue Peter presenter Peter Purves.
